Question

what happens when the kinetic energy of molecules increases so much that electrons are released by the atoms, creating a swirling gas of positive ions and negative electrons?

matter changes to a plasma state
matter changes to a liquid state
matter changes to a solid state
matter changes to a gaseous state

Explanation:

Analyze the physical process described

The question describes a scenario where the kinetic energy of molecules increases significantly. This extreme thermal energy causes atoms to lose their electrons (ionization).

Identify the resulting state of matter

The ionization process produces a mixture of free electrons and positive ions. This highly ionized gas-like state of matter is defined as plasma.

Match with the given options

  • "Matter changes to a plasma state" matches the description of ionization and plasma formation.
  • "Matter changes to a liquid state" is incorrect (liquids consist of neutral molecules/atoms with low kinetic energy).
  • "Matter changes to a solid state" is incorrect (solids have the lowest kinetic energy).
  • "Matter changes to a gaseous state" is incorrect (gases consist of neutral atoms or molecules, not free ions and electrons).
